Transaction cfd61acb1c0127bfff759591557c6be379ed39b158b8febf60b9f501fe8c5489
1 Input
1 Output
-
cfd61acb1c0127bfff759591557c6be379ed39b158b8febf60b9f501fe8c5489:0
- value
- 587509
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 80b4927e5d7c870e85316058cb46ae87c4d3ea4f OP_EQUAL
- address
- 3DRYjUdqFQ8o7WHAepQL9Rfcjm4hLi55ao